    February 10 SOTD:

    Razor: Gillette Aristocrat Jr
    Blade: Polsilver
    Brush: PAA The Solar Flare
    Lather: PAA Al Fin
    Aftershave: PAA Al Fin

    Well, it is finished. This is my last PAA set (although I do admit to having a few AS splashes that are not matched to soaps). It wasn't planned this way, but the name is fitting for the end. This is a lovely scent, one that made it into my top 15 PAA scents. The rose strikes me at first, but there is much more there. This one has some depth to it as the tobacco begins to enter the picture. After a bit Vetiver comes along and just really adds to this scent. These primary notes could carry this just fine, but there is also a bit if citrus in the background along with a hint of woodiness. I did not get a comment this morning, but this one has earned the coveted SWMBOSOA (©️ @Primotenore ) in the past. After a while, this scent is reminiscent of Fine Fresh Vetiver, but honestly it has a lot more going on to my nose. Just a great scent.

    This little exercise has shown me a few things. One, I definitely like PAA soap performance. The CK6 base is an improvement over the CK1 base, but both a great performers IMO. Second, I enjoyed spending a little time and ranking these scents. It was interesting to look at how the rankings ended up as tobacco shows up in several of the tops scents I have, but so does Frankincense and Myrrh, and these scents often have a woody component. The last thing this time has shown me is that I may have a slight problem when it comes to PAA.

    In terms of ranking, I will just say that the top 5, maybe the top 10 are soaps I will likely always have in my den as long as they are offered. I would not hesitate to buy just about all of them, except possibly 1 or 2 at the end of the list. Either my standards are low, or PAA does a good job with their scents. That is for others to decide. :)

    My list is attached for this who are interested. I hope everyone has a great day!
